Allstate Insurance Home Insurance and Mildew Damage

Understanding what the Allstate Company handles mold damage claims is vital for property owners . Typically, standard dwelling insurance policies often exclude damage stemming from mildew growth, especially if it’s due to lack of maintenance or a previous moisture issue that wasn’t repaired. However, Allstate might give reimbursement if the mold damage is a direct consequence of a covered peril like a water line break or a natural disaster . This is , closely checking your contract and submitting a detailed claim with the Allstate Company are necessary steps in evaluating potential reimbursement . Think about contacting an the Allstate Company agent for details regarding your specific circumstances .

Preventing Mold Growth A Practical Guide

To hinder mold growth , a sensible guide focuses on managing moisture . Often examine your property for leaks , particularly in bathrooms and around windows . Verify adequate airflow by using air purifiers and fixing any condensation promptly. Remove water stains immediately, and think about using a moisture absorber in enclosed areas .

Mold Removal Expenses

Dealing with mildew contamination in your home can be a difficult experience, and understanding the related remediation costs is crucial, particularly when filing a claim with a insurance provider like Allstate. Typically , mold remediation can range from a few hundred dollars for a small, localized area to several thousand, or even tens of thousands, for extensive infestations. Factors influencing the overall price include the size of the issue , the type of mold , the degree of water damage that caused it, and the essential repairs to impacted building materials . When you discover mold , document everything with images and seek professional inspection immediately. About Allstate claims, insurance for mold remediation is often restricted and requires proof of a covered incident, such as a burst pipe or a ceiling leak . It's best to examine your insurance agreement carefully and contact Allstate directly to determine your particular benefits and claim steps.

Frequent Mold Concerns and Remedies

Many homes face fungus issues , typically due to excess moisture . Frequent areas affected feature showers , foundations, and kitchens . Indications can be a stale odor , apparent spots of green development , and discoloration on materials. Fixing these situations requires finding the source of the dampness and using effective actions . This might involve fixing seepage, enhancing ventilation , and applying a mildew treatment. Expert support may be recommended for significant growth .

Detecting Mold Quickly: A Property Owner’s Inspection List

Catching mildew presence soon is critical for preventing significant damage to your house. Here's a basic list to assist you spot potential issues. To begin with, look for earthy scents, particularly in cellars, washrooms, and around pipes. Then, assess areas and ceilings for blemishes, water stains, or apparent mildew. In conclusion, be mindful of any locations with limited airflow or a record of moisture. If you find anything suspicious, it’s recommended to contact a professional fungus inspector.
